    1. Background

      Canadian Coast Guard (CCG) took acceptance of nine new “Hero Class” Mid-Shore Patrol Vessel (MSPVs) built by Irving Shipyards between 2012 and 2014. The vessels operate across the country in salt, brackish and fresh waters.

      MSPVs use an Allied crane (MODEL TB10-23) for the launching and recovering of Rigid Hull Inflatable Boat (RHIBs) and for cargo handling. This crane was designed to launch RHIBs dynamically in weather up to Sea State 5.

      This training is in response to several hazardous occurrences.

      A Hazardous Occurrence #HO-CA-2017-143 involved a RHIB being lowered uncontrollably on to the deck, injuring crew members. This was due to a fault in the Constant Tension function and as a result up until recently Constant Tension had been disabled on vessels.

      A resulting action plan was generated, including direction for the constant tension function.

      This training is to meet the recommendations of the resulting action plan, and to coincide with the reactivation of the Constant Tension function.
